Hire an Asbestos Attorney

A mesothelioma lawyer is an excellent option for anyone diagnosed with asbestos-related disease. They can assist individuals in filing an injury lawsuit for personal injury or trust fund claim. VA claim to recover compensation.

Mesothelioma lawyers combine legal expertise with compassion and care. They work to make the litigation process as easy as is possible for their clientele.

Chris Panatier

Asbestos lawyers understand that families of victims need legal help as quickly as possible to ensure they can receive the justice they deserve. They will make the process as easy as possible, so that clients can concentrate on their health and the wellbeing of their loved family members. Attorneys can help victims by filing an injury claim or wrongful death lawsuit against asbestos-related firms or submitting a claim through an asbestos trust fund for bankruptcy.

A mesothelioma lawyer who is skilled will have access to the best asbestos lawsuits experts and research to build a strong case for their clients. They will be familiar with asbestos laws in different states and can assist their clients file claims with different jurisdictions. They also have access to a vast resource network that can help locate potential asbestos exposure sources even if the victim is unable to remember where it occurred.

Mesothelioma is a kind of cancer that grows in the tissues that line the body cavities, including the lungs and abdomen. The cancer can be fatal and usually takes years to get an diagnosis. Asbestos victims, and their families, deserve compensation for their losses. This includes past and future medical expenses.

A lawyer who has experience in asbestos law will only be paid only if their client is successful. They are able to then deal with more complex cases, and seek larger verdicts. They also work with clients to determine the best strategy for their case, and also what damages they might be entitled to.

Mesothelioma can be caused by asbestos exposure. This harmful substance was used for decades in the construction and manufacturing industry. Workers in these industries were exposed to asbestos fibers, which can be inhaled and then lodged in the lung and tissue. This can cause various diseases including mesothelioma.
